Summary

The Washington Nationals are seeking a strategic and results-driven Director of Group Sales to lead all aspects of the club’s group ticketing and hospitality business. Reporting to the Senior Vice President of Ticket Sales & Services, this individual will oversee a team of Account Executives and a Manager of Group Sales Logistics & Hospitality, collectively responsible for achieving and surpassing the organization’s annual Group Sales and Hospitality revenue and paid ticket goals.

The Director of Group Sales will design and execute comprehensive business plans and sales strategies across all group inventory, including traditional groups (13+ tickets), Group Hospitality Spaces, Special Ticket Events, and Fan Experience Packages (FEPs). This leader will play a pivotal role in shaping departmental culture, developing talent, driving innovation, and creating memorable experiences that grow attendance, strengthen community connections, and deliver measurable results.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Develop and implement the department’s annual business plan, including revenue goals, sales strategies, and alignment with the Nationals’ overall ticket sales vision and culture.
  • Lead, coach, and mentor the Manager of Group Sales, Hospitality & Logistics, as well as a team of Group Sales Account Executives, fostering a culture of accountability, professional growth, and consistent achievement of sales targets.
  • Maintain full accountability for revenue performance, sales pacing, and key departmental metrics while cultivating a positive, high-performance environment.
  • Partner with senior leadership to forecast revenue, manage expense budgets, and ensure operational alignment with broader organizational objectives.
  • Conceptualize, develop, and execute innovative group products,Listen experiences, theme nights, and community-driven initiatives that generate new revenue streams and enhance retention among existing clients.
  • Oversee the creation, pricing, and fulfillment of group ticket offerings, including traditional group sales (13+ tickets), hospitality areas, Special Ticket Events, and Fan Experience Packages (FEPs).
  • Manage and refine dynamic pricing strategies to maximize yield and respond effectively to market demand.
  • Identify and cultivate new business opportunities through targeted outreach, partnerships, and creative marketing collaborations.
  • Build strong cross-departmental partnerships with Marketing, Operations, Guest Experience, and Ballpark Events to ensure seamless event execution and exceptional client experiences.
  • Collaborate with CRM and Analytics teams to optimize lead generation, targeting, and campaign performance.
  • Partner closely with Ticket Operations and Service teams to ensure accuracy, efficiency, and excellence throughout the sales and fulfillment process.
  • Develop and maintain relationships with key clients,community organizations, schools, youth leagues, and local businesses to expand the Nationals’ group base and community footprint.
  • Represent the Washington Nationals at internal, client-facing, and community events to promote group offerings and elevate brand visibility.
  • Oversee the planning and delivery of Special Ticket Events and Fan Experience Packages to ensure alignment with fan interests, community initiatives, and organizational goals.
  • Monitor team performance, CRM activity, and revenue pacing through regular data-driven analysis and reporting.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the Senior Vice President of Ticket Sales & Service or senior leadership.
  • Represent the Washington Nationals at offsite community and networking events to promote ticket opportunities and enhance brand presence.
  • Gameday responsibilities include serving as Manager on Duty and assisting in Ticket Sales/Services initiatives.

Compensation

The projected salary for this position is $100,000 - $115,000 per year. This position is also eligible for commissions based on the Nationals Ticket Sales incentive program. Actual pay is based on several factors, including but not limited to the applicant’s: qualifications, skills, expertise, education/training, certifications, and other organization requirements. Starting salaries for new employees are frequently not at the top of the applicable salary range.
